Investment Product Analyst, Specialist
2 weeks ago
The Investment Product Analyst supports Vanguard's multi-asset products and model portfolios through reporting, research, and analysis. This role ensures product health, empowers distribution teams, and contributes to strategic positioning and education efforts. The analyst collaborates with investment teams, sales, marketing, and legal to deliver insights and maintain competitive positioning.
Core Responsibilities
- Builds and produces key reports on a regular basis on Vanguard multi-asset offering, industry trends and the Canadian economy.
- Supports the creation of dynamic content used to position Vanguard's products and models. Develops and maintains broad knowledge and awareness of the investment industry, competition, and Vanguard's fund line-up. Assists with the creation of thought leadership commentary.
- Supports Vanguard's Investment Strategy Group by providing economic research including Canadian economic indicators and statistics. Generates appropriate charts, tables on the Canadian economy, obtains and organizes readily available data.
- Detail orientated and able to conduct attribution analysis on portfolios providing both quantitative and qualitative insights.
- Develops and maintains competitor research, analysis, and monitoring that supports better business understanding of competitors' offerings, drives positioning of Vanguard's offer, and supports distribution.
- Utilizes department resources to respond to queries. Manages the support process, recommending process guidelines to management and the business.
- Develops and maintains relationships across the organization including the investment teams, sales, marketing, and legal.
- Maintains a client-focused, team-oriented, and data-driven mindset building investment expertise in areas such as asset allocation, portfolio construction and product design features.
- Continues personal development of analytical and presentation skills.
- Participates in special projects and performs other duties as assigned.
Qualifications
- Three years related work experience, including one year experience in the investment industry.
- Strong analytical, interpersonal and communication skills
- Undergraduate degree with demonstrated success in academics.
- CFA enrollment preferred
- Familiarity with tools like Bloomberg, Morningstar Direct, FactSet, MatLab an asset
- Proven history of motivation and initiative
